    From Wikipedia:
    Barnabas Collins is a fictional character, one of the feature characters in the ABC soap opera serial Dark Shadows. Originally played by Canadian actor Jonathan Frid, Barnabas was a self-loathing yet sympathetic 175-year-old vampire. In the 1991 NBC revival series of Dark Shadows, British actor Ben Cross played the role of Barnabas Collins.

    Depp wants a bite of Dark Shadows movie
    Staff and agencies
    Friday July 27, 2007
    Guardian Unlimited
    Johnny Depp will play a vampire in the big screen version of the cult ABC soap Dark Shadows. Depp is producing with Graham King, the north London power player who won an Oscar earlier this year for Martin Scorsese's The Departed. The actor told reporters he has always harboured a desire to play Barnabas Collins, the head of a gruesome clan whose supernatural antics drew a fanatical following from 1966-71. Depp and King have several other projects on the books, notably Shantaram, the sprawling Gregory David Roberts yarn that Mira Nair will direct, and a story about the life of the poisoned Russian spy Alexander Litvinenko.
